当前位置:网站首页 > Node.js开发 > 正文

使用git commit时‘“node“‘ 不是内部或外部命令,也不是可运行的程序

一,现象

项目是使用了husky,在使用git comit的时候,会调用pre-commit的node代码,这里找不到对应的node环境变量,所以报错了。
在这里插入图片描述

二,解决

首先,我使用node -v。可以看到版本号,这就说明,node的环境变量配置并没有问题。
然后,使用git BASH命令行工具来执行git commit,结果还是一样,这说明不是vscode的问题。
再则,换一个有配置husky的项目,执行git commit 发现一样的结果,这又排除了是项目的配置被人修改导致的问题。

躺地上哭会后,我又爬起来想了会:

昨天之前还都可以的,但是今天不得行了。

这是为啥?

昨天到今天,我做了啥?

肯德基疯狂星期四???

应该不是,没人v我50。

那就是我昨天安装了一个java的项目管理工具。在系统变量的环境变量中新增了一条:

在这里插入图片描述
把那个分号去掉,试了一下,就可以了!

我特么

不理解啊!!

这比肯德基疯狂星期四还离谱好不!!!!

到此这篇使用git commit时‘“node“‘ 不是内部或外部命令,也不是可运行的程序的文章就介绍到这了,更多相关内容请继续浏览下面的相关推荐文章,希望大家都能在编程的领域有一番成就!

版权声明


相关文章:

  • mac上nvm切换node版本无效2024-11-28 15:36:09
  • 使用node自动化创建文件及其模板2024-11-28 15:36:09
  • node-sass安装不上的问题2024-11-28 15:36:09
  • Node学习(四)-npm概述——使用npm安装第三方模块之全局安装、本地局部安装2024-11-28 15:36:09
  • Node学习(五)01-express框架——使用express搭建web服务器 & 启动命令之node或nodemon+空格+文件相对路径 __dirname指当前文件所在文件夹的绝对路径2024-11-28 15:36:09
  • docker基础(四)-制作镜像部署node后端项目2024-11-28 15:36:09
  • 安装node(安装node.js)2024-11-28 15:36:09
  • 安装node js(安装nodejs教程)2024-11-28 15:36:09
  • nodejs安装及其配置环境变量(node.js配置环境变量)2024-11-28 15:36:09
  • node安装npm -v错误(node安装后npm不能用)2024-11-28 15:36:09
  • 全屏图片